Nikolai
Anatolievich Zhuravlev

Russia • Vologda • born in 1949
Graphic artist, painter, member of the Union of Artists of Russia.
Born November 13, 1949 in Petrozavodsk. Permanently lives and works in Vologda since 1960. Studied at Yaroslavl Art School (1965-1969). Member of the Union of Russian Artists since 1991. The artist works in the techniques of the original schedule: charcoal drawing, pastel. Appeals to an architectural landscape, still life, portrait. In his creative work he continues traditions of the Russian realistic art. In recent years he is actively engaged in painting. Nikolai Anatolievich works worthy represent the Vologda fine art at exhibitions at various levels: II International Pastel Exhibition "Italy - 2002" (Yaroslavl, 2003, 2004), III International Pastel Exhibition (St. Petersburg, 2005), XII All-Russian exhibition "Russia" (Moscow, 2014), IX, X, XI interregional art exhibitions "Russian North" (Vologda, 2003; Veliky Novgorod, 2008; Syktyvkar, 2013), participant of all regional exhibitions. Solo exhibitions of graphics and paintings: Vologda (1983), Tarnogsky Gorodok, the Vologda region (1998, 1999, 2000, 2012). Works of the artist are in the collection of the Vologda State Museum and museums of the Vologda region. Works by Nikolai Anatolievich repeatedly purchased by the Exhibitions Directorate of the Art Fund of the RSFSR, entered the collections of the Vologda Regional Picture Gallery, Tarnog Museum of Traditional Folk Culture, private collectors in Russia and abroad. N.A. Zhuravlev for active creative work and participation in exhibitions was awarded with Honorary Diploma of the Department of Culture (2009), Acknowledgement of the Department of Culture (2014), Silver Medal "Spirituality, Traditions, Skill" of All-Russian Art Society "Union of Artists of Russia" (2014).
